Ordinals
beta
Address bc1qhfvvx83qavh9fv72mx22y4yc7kpg4lqgp06cn3
sat balance
17515871
runes balances
outputs
ef9eb38224565fcb258700a24a3ac90d4702ed4a8bb237c233ab145a15e37584:29